Unveiling the 2021 Chevrolet Spark: A First Look
Alright, let's kick things off with a little introduction. The 2021 Chevrolet Spark is a subcompact hatchback, and it's all about providing affordable, fuel-efficient transportation. Think of it as the ultimate urban runabout – perfect for zipping through crowded city streets and squeezing into those ridiculously tight parking spots. Right off the bat, you'll notice its playful, youthful design. It's got a cheeky personality, with its compact dimensions and available vibrant color options. The Spark is available in several trims: LS, 1LT, ACTIV, and 2LT. Each trim offers a slightly different take on the Spark's personality, from the base LS with its focus on value to the sporty ACTIV trim with its unique styling and ride height. Interior and Technology Features
Now, let's step inside the 2021 Chevy Spark and see what it's got going on! Don't let the Spark's small size fool you; the interior is surprisingly functional. Getting in, you'll find that the doors open wide, making entry and exit a breeze. The seats, while not the plushest, are comfortable enough for everyday driving. The front seats offer decent support, and even taller drivers should find enough headroom. The rear seats are best suited for occasional use, but they can comfortably accommodate two adults. The layout inside is simple and user-friendly. The dashboard is clean, and all the controls are within easy reach. The infotainment system is a key highlight, as it includes a 7-inch touchscreen display that supports Apple CarPlay and Android Auto. This is a massive win, as it allows you to seamlessly integrate your smartphone for navigation, music, and hands-free calling. The system is responsive and easy to use, making it a joy to interact with. Other tech features include a Wi-Fi hotspot, which is a fantastic addition for staying connected on the go. You also get a USB port for charging your devices. The Spark also includes a rearview camera, which is a must-have for parking in tight spaces. Speaking of which, the Spark's small size makes it incredibly easy to maneuver and park. Visibility is excellent, thanks to its large windows and compact dimensions. The interior materials are what you'd expect for a car in this price range. You won't find any luxury finishes, but the plastics are durable, and everything feels well-assembled. Driving Experience: How Does the Spark Perform?
Alright, let's get down to the fun part: the driving experience. Under the hood of the 2021 Chevy Spark, you'll find a 1.4-liter four-cylinder engine. Now, before you start thinking it's underpowered, remember this is a small car designed for city driving. The engine produces 98 horsepower, which is enough to get you around town and merge onto the highway. The Spark isn't going to win any races, but it's surprisingly peppy in urban environments. The engine feels lively, and the car is easy to maneuver. The transmission is a CVT (Continuously Variable Transmission) or a five-speed manual, depending on the trim level. The CVT is smooth and efficient, and it helps to maximize fuel economy. The manual transmission offers a more engaging driving experience for those who prefer it. One of the standout features of the Spark is its fuel efficiency. It's rated at up to 30 mpg in the city and 38 mpg on the highway, making it a super economical choice. This means fewer trips to the gas station and more money in your pocket. The ride quality is decent for a car of this size. It's not going to float over bumps, but the suspension does a good job of absorbing most road imperfections. The Spark feels stable and composed, even at highway speeds. Handling is another strong point. The car is nimble and responsive, making it easy to navigate through tight city streets. The steering is light and precise, which is perfect for parking and maneuvering. Safety is also a key consideration, and the Spark comes with a decent array of safety features. These include a rearview camera, ten airbags, and available advanced safety features like forward collision alert and lane departure warning.
